Name

       afp_voluuid.conf — Configuration file used by afpd to specify UUID for AFP volumes

Description

       afp_voluuid.conf  is  the  configuration  file  used  by  afpd  to  store  UUID  of  all AFP volumes. The
       configuration lines are composed like:

              "volume-name" "uuid-string"

       The first field is the volume name. Volume names must be quoted if they contain spaces. The second  field
       is the 36 character hexadecimal ASCII string representation of a UUID.

       All  leading spaces and tabs are ignored. Blank lines are ignored. The lines prefixed with # are ignored.
       Any illegal lines are ignored.

              NOTE

              This UUID is advertised by Zeroconf in order to provide  robust  disambiguation  of  Time  Machine
              volumes.

              It is also used by the MySQL CNID backend.

              This file should not be thoughtlessly edited or copied onto another server.

Examples

   Example: afp_voluuid.conf with three volumes
              # This is a comment.
              "Backup for John Smith" 1573974F-0ABD-69CC-C40A-8519B681A0E1
              "bob" 39A487F4-55AA-8240-E584-69AA01800FE9
              mary 6331E2D1-446C-B68C-3066-D685AADBE911
